The Japan Times, Ltd. is a prominent newspaper publisher headquartered in Japan, recognised for delivering high-quality journalism both domestically and internationally. Established in 1897, the company has a long-standing history of providing reliable news coverage across various sectors, including politics, business, culture, and society. Its flagship publication, The Japan Times, is renowned for its comprehensive reporting and in-depth analysis, serving a diverse readership within Japan and abroad.
As a leading player in the newspaper publishing industry, The Japan Times, Ltd. has built a strong reputation for independent journalism and innovative media offerings. Its core services include print and digital news platforms, which are distinguished by their commitment to accuracy and insightful storytelling. With a significant presence in the Japanese media landscape, the company continues to uphold its position as a trusted source of information and a key contributor to Japan’s media industry.

The Japan Times, Ltd., a Japanese newspaper publisher, does not publicly report its carbon emissions data. Therefore, specific Scope 1, 2, or 3 emissions figures are unavailable. The company has not set any specific emissions reduction targets, nor is it committed to initiatives like the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i) or The Climate Pledge. As a current subsidiary, its climate commitments and performance are not currently cascaded from a parent entity.
